LEGO The Lord of the Rings (Nintendo DS, 2012)

Gamers can relive Peter Jackson's version of J.R.R. Tolkien's epic trilogy (albeit with small plastic blocks and vintage Traveller's Tales humor) as they join Frodo, Aragorn, and the rest of the Fellowship in LEGO The Lord of the Rings. All of Middle-earth has been re-created, even portions not seen in the films, but players follow the general progression of the story, travelling from The Shire all the way to the heart of Mordor. As always, gamers spend much of the adventure switching between characters, dismantling foes, and destroying the environments to earn LEGO studs. There are more than 80 different characters to unlock, including the massive spider Shelob, the frightening Balrog, and the tortured hobbit Gollum, and the game includes dozens of lines of dialogue taken directly from the films. Players can collect Mithril to forge new items in the Blacksmith Shop, and characters gain new weapons and attacks as the advance through the journey. Special Palantir seeing stones let gamers jump back and forth between storylines, and as always, multiplayer fans can drop in or out of the action any time they please.
